It was open. What I call the dump is actually a transfer station. 30+ years ago Spokane County put a waste to energy plant in use west of town and two transfer stations, one north and one east. Trash is moved from the stations to the burner via truck. The transfer stations are only closed on major holidays.

Drive safe. I have Utah CFP (5yrss) and Oregon CHL (4yrs). Utah gives me the ability to carry in 31 states. Oregon is just Oregon, so total of 32 states. I did not have to travel to Utah to get it. I had to provide proof of training from a Utah recognized/certified training organization and proof of ID. I do not remember what the fees were.Hatchdog wrote: ↑Tue Dec 03, 2024 8:48 am...
